WebWhat is data curation? Data curation is the process of creating, organizing and maintaining data sets so they can be accessed and used by people looking for information. It involves collecting, … WebApr 26, 2024 · The Data Staging Area is a temporary storage area for data copied from Source Systems. In a Data Warehousing Architecture, a Data Staging Area is mostly necessary for time considerations. The purpose of the … slp-mcherryData curation is the organization and integration of data collected from various sources. It involves annotation, publication and presentation of the data such that the value of the data is maintained over time, and the data remains available for reuse and preservation.
